Having long experience in developing and delivering all-electric operating systems for side-rolling hatches has led to improved versions for the maritime shipping sector. The latest, MacRack, for example, employs a combined rack-and-pinion drive and lifter system, eliminating the need for separate hatch cover lifters.

Reliability, safety, and reduced expenses

Compared to hydraulic solutions, MacGregor's electric drive offers several key benefits for shipowners and shipyards:

  • Easier installation and fewer components, reducing CAPEX
  • A single solution for both drive and lift operations
  • Lower maintenance requirements and effort, reducing OPEX
  • Eliminates the need for installing or maintaining hydraulic components such as piping
  • Less sensitivity to colder climates
